Ripster that 72 looks like a Goldpan special.Ripster wrote: ↑Sat Dec 21, 2024 1:29 am Here’s a Camillus 72 with some Ebony and ivory . And a 4 and 1/2 inch D.S.&K. Dame,Stoddard & Kendall was a sporting goods outfit out of Boston . Have dates of 1880 to 1901 for this stamp. Could be off a little as I don’t know much about this one . It’s a solid,very well built knife. Very tight and locks up great .

A pair of Booth Brothers hawks in ebony. One from Sussex and one from Stockholm, N.J. They were made in 4 different locations in N.J. in their 43 years of manufacture. I'd like to complete the set. J.O'.

I had this Union ebony serpentine jack out to post in another thread and thought it should be here too. It is 3 and 1/2 inches closed, and is a pattern #1246.
